Avatar

1916 · 50 min Drama Fantasy
5.0 / 10 · TMDB

Based on Théophile Gautier's novel of the same name, the film tells of the tragic love affair of Ottavio de Saville. He falls madly in love with Madame Prascovie Labinska, a woman very faithful to her husband, the Polish count Olaf Labinski. Alarmed by the growing physical and mental weariness of the desperate young man, his relatives and friends decide to turn to Doctor Balthazar, who has just returned from a trip to the Indies where he was initiated into the secrets of Brahman.

📋 Film Details

Year 1916
Country Italy
Genre Drama, Fantasy
Director Carmine Gallone
Runtime 50 min.
